  • Registered Users Posts: 32,417 ✭✭✭✭watty


    The upload speeds are about x2 similar DSL packages.

    The phone service is a dedicated kind of VOIP over a private network, so unlike 3rd Party VOIP such as Blueface or Skype, the "Quality of Service" and phone socket is "built in".

    I was with Digiweb in Drogheda until recently and from my experience the service is very good when it works! As it is a line of sight product, heavy rain, snow and fog will all interfere with your signal and you will need a clear line of sight to their antenna which is located on the Lourdes hospital. Finally I would point out that I found the phone service to be quite unreliable although that was not a major problem as I rarely used it.
